Yanks' Cabrera, Duncan suspended for roles in fight

1:18 PM Fri, Mar 14, 2008 | | Write a comment
By Mike McDermott    Email

NEW YORK (AP) - Yankees center fielder Melky Cabrera and first baseman Shelley Duncan were suspended for three games each for their roles in Wednesday's spring-training fracas between New York and the Tampa Bay Rays. Tampa outfielder Jonny Gomes was......
